    Rosso Horse by Jonty Hurwitz – £27,000

    Paint, Copper and Stainless Steel

    40x40x45cm

     

    Jonty Hurwitz’s sculpture is inspired by his early childhood experiences with the animal kingdom and his years spent with horses on the narrow bridle path near his home in the English countryside. It serves as a meditation on freedom by symbolising the suppressed inner nature of domesticated animals. Through this creative work of art, Hurwitz captures the wild spirit of horses, while simultaneously highlighting the irony of a world where they are largely ‘owned’. The sculpture honors the idea that horses, and other domesticated creatures, possess an in-built understanding of independence, freedom and self-sufficiency in spite of the disconnection of modern civilization from nature. This unique artwork explores the bond between the animal and its natural habitat, the power of freedom and its lack, and the ways in which our modern scientific civilization attempts to rein it in.

    Elephant & Calf by Suzie Marsh – £4,995

    A completely unique foundry bronze by Suzie Marsh

    Suzie sculpts in clay before firing it to stoneware to give a suitable medium for the foundry to work from. The hot bronze casting technique is unsurpassed in it’s quality, bring the sculpture to life the way no other medium can. Nelson the Seal was Suzie’s first public commission in bronze. Foundry Bronze sculptures are suitable for house and garden.

    Koru & Totem Ram by Min Reid – £9,000

    Koru & Totem Ram £9,000

    KORU (pronounced kor-roo)

    The KORU (Māori for “loop” or “coil”) holds deep significance and meaning in Māori culture in New Zealand (Aotearoa) with it’s spiral shape based on the appearance of a new unfurling silver fern frond.

    New Life, Growth, Strength & Peace

    Its shape conveys the idea of perpetual movement while the inner coil suggests returning to the point of origin. 

    TOTEM RAM 

    The Ram embodies determination, power, and leadership. Unafraid of failure, it sees it as a path to greater things. Taking charge of your own life inspires others to step out of their comfort zones and embrace life with courage.

    Strength & Courage 

    Be True to Yourself

    The horns on Totem Ram signify the KORU, hence the perfect juxtaposition of the two.

    RED

    The colour red in Asia is auspicious, associated with life-generating energy (the sun, blood, and fire) and is the colour of celebrations and prosperity. It is also the colour of the blossom of the Pōhutukawa Tree (also known as the New Zealand Christmas tree as it blossoms in December).
